roaminghippy wrote: »hi
After a few emails to chessington i have found out that you CAN NOT use a tesco voucher ( the type you exchange you clubcard points for) to enter if you are disabled........this sounds like discrimination to me ......am i right in thinking this or am i missing something??
Possibly it is but then is it not discrimination that disabled guests receive preferential pricing and ride access at Merlin Group attractions (IncludingChessington)?
BTW, there is nothing stopping you using Tesco vouchers to gain entry to Chessingtonas a disabled person, You would however be charged at the same rate (in TescoVouchers) as everybody else and would not receive a complimentary careradmission. However as disable visitor, you would still get preferential ride access.0 -
